Types of IT Services

The range of IT services available to businesses is vast, and choosing the right services depends on the specific needs and goals of the organization. Below are some of the most common types of IT services:

1. Managed IT Services

Managed IT services involve outsourcing the management of a company's IT infrastructure to a third-party provider. This can include everything from network monitoring and maintenance to data backup and disaster recovery. Managed services are ideal for businesses that lack the in-house expertise or resources to manage their IT systems effectively. By partnering with a managed service provider (MSP), companies can ensure that their IT infrastructure is continuously monitored and optimized.

2. Cloud Computing Services

Cloud computing has revolutionized the way businesses store, manage, and access data. Cloud services allow companies to store data on remote servers, enabling employees to access information from anywhere with an internet connection. This flexibility is particularly beneficial for remote work and collaboration. Additionally, cloud computing services offer scalability, allowing businesses to expand their storage and processing capabilities as needed without investing in costly hardware.

3. Cybersecurity Services

With the rise of cyber threats, cybersecurity services are essential for protecting a company's digital assets. These services include threat detection, firewall management, data encryption, and vulnerability assessments. Cybersecurity providers also offer training programs to educate employees on best practices for safeguarding sensitive information. By implementing robust security measures, businesses can protect themselves from data breaches and financial losses.

4. IT Support and Help Desk Services

IT support and help desk services provide businesses with immediate assistance when technical issues arise. Whether it's troubleshooting software problems, resolving network outages, or providing hardware repairs, IT support teams ensure that operations continue smoothly. Help desk services are particularly valuable for companies that rely heavily on technology for day-to-day tasks, as they provide quick resolutions to minimize downtime.

5. Network Management Services

A well-functioning network is essential for any business that relies on digital communication and data transfer. Network management services involve monitoring, maintaining, and optimizing a company's network infrastructure. This includes managing routers, switches, firewalls, and other networking equipment to ensure that data flows efficiently and securely. Network management services also include performance monitoring and troubleshooting to prevent and resolve connectivity issues.

6. Data Backup and Recovery Services

Data is one of the most valuable assets for any business. Data backup and recovery services ensure that a company's data is regularly backed up and can be restored in the event of data loss or system failure. These services are critical for protecting against data breaches, accidental deletions, hardware failures, and natural disasters. By implementing reliable backup solutions, businesses can safeguard their information and minimize the impact of data loss.

7. Software Development and Integration Services

Many businesses require custom software solutions to meet their specific needs. Software development services involve designing, developing, and deploying software applications tailored to a company's requirements. Additionally, integration services ensure that new software seamlessly integrates with existing systems. Whether it's developing a new mobile app, automating business processes, or implementing a CRM system, software development services provide the technical expertise needed to bring ideas to life.

8. IT Consulting Services

IT consulting services help businesses develop strategies for leveraging technology to achieve their goals. IT consultants work with companies to assess their current IT infrastructure, identify areas for improvement, and recommend solutions that align with the company's objectives. Consulting services are valuable for businesses looking to implement new technologies, optimize their existing systems, or develop long-term IT plans.

The Benefits of Outsourcing IT Services

Outsourcing IT services to a third-party provider offers several advantages, particularly for small and medium-sized businesses that may lack the resources to manage their IT infrastructure in-house.

1. Cost Savings

Outsourcing IT services can be more cost-effective than maintaining an in-house IT department. Businesses can reduce expenses related to hiring, training, and retaining IT staff, as well as the costs associated with purchasing and maintaining hardware and software. Instead, they pay a predictable monthly fee for the services they need.

2. Access to Expertise

IT service providers have specialized knowledge and experience in managing complex IT systems. By outsourcing, businesses gain access to a team of experts who stay up-to-date with the latest technologies and best practices. This expertise ensures that the company's IT infrastructure is optimized for performance and security.

3. Scalability

As businesses grow, their IT needs evolve. Outsourcing IT services allows companies to scale their IT infrastructure quickly and efficiently. Whether it's expanding cloud storage, adding new software applications, or increasing cybersecurity measures, service providers can adapt to the changing requirements of the business.

4. Focus on Core Business Activities

By outsourcing IT services, businesses can focus on their core operations without being distracted by technical issues. This allows employees to concentrate on their primary tasks, improving productivity and driving growth. IT service providers handle the day-to-day management of the IT infrastructure, ensuring that the company's technology needs are met without disrupting business operations.

5. Improved Security

Cybersecurity is a top concern for businesses of all sizes. Outsourcing IT services to a provider that specializes in cybersecurity ensures that the company is protected against the latest threats. Service providers implement advanced security measures, conduct regular vulnerability assessments, and monitor for potential breaches. This proactive approach helps businesses stay ahead of cyber threats and protect their valuable data.
